Germans - Deutsche in Amerika

Combining vivid portraits with frank interviews, Gunter Klötzer's Germans in Amerika project presents a compelling portrayal of Germans living in America today. For 10 months beginning in summer 2003, Klötzer photographed some 120 individuals and asked them to answer the same set of questions about their decisions to come to the US. The resulting images and texts became part of an exhibition displayed in the United States and Germany, a book and now an interactive website.
